PeerFinder.FindAllPeersAsync Método

Definición

Examina de forma asincrónica los dispositivos del mismo nivel que ejecutan la misma aplicación dentro del intervalo inalámbrico.

Comentarios

Si la aplicación se ejecuta en un equipo, puede buscar equipos del mismo nivel que ejecuten la aplicación. En este caso, la detección del mismo nivel se realiza en Wi-Fi Direct. Si la aplicación se ejecuta en un teléfono, puede buscar teléfonos del mismo nivel que ejecutan la aplicación. En este caso, la detección del mismo nivel se realiza a través de Bluetooth. Dado que el transporte usado para la detección del mismo nivel difiere entre pc y teléfono, la aplicación que se ejecuta en un equipo solo puede encontrar equipos del mismo nivel y la aplicación que se ejecuta en un teléfono solo puede encontrar teléfonos del mismo nivel.

Cuando la operación de exploración asincrónica finaliza correctamente, devuelve una lista de elementos del mismo nivel que están dentro del intervalo inalámbrico. Un elemento del mismo nivel es un dispositivo que tiene una aplicación que se ejecuta en primer plano con un identificador de aplicación coincidente. Un elemento del mismo nivel también puede tener un identificador de examen coincidente especificado como una identidad alternativa. Para obtener más información, vea AlternateIdentities.

Si una aplicación llama al método ConnectAsync para crear una conexión con un mismo nivel, la aplicación ya no anunciará una conexión y no la encontrará el método FindAllPeersAsync hasta que la aplicación llame al método Close para cerrar la conexión de socket.

Solo encontrará elementos del mismo nivel en los que el dispositivo está dentro del intervalo inalámbrico y la aplicación del mismo nivel se ejecuta en primer plano. Si una aplicación del mismo nivel se ejecuta en segundo plano, la proximidad no anuncia las conexiones del mismo nivel.

Como alternativa al método FindAllPeersAsync, puede buscar dinámicamente aplicaciones del mismo nivel a medida que se detectan dentro del intervalo mediante el objeto PeerWatcher .

Windows Phone 8

Wi-Fi Direct no se admite en Windows Phone 8.
